Maintenance Playbook
Pump every 3 years for typical households; shorten the interval with large families or disposal use. Stagger laundry loads, avoid bleach-heavy cleaners, and keep wipes out of the system.
Move roof runoff away from the drain field. Keep grass cover, avoid heavy vehicles, and mark lids so service is swift. Store permits and past reports for a complete history.
